Question 1058310: Two persons contrsted an election of parliament. The winning candidate secured 57% of the total valid votes polled and won by a majority of 42,000 votes. The number of total votes polled is? Answer by jorel555(1290) (Show Source):
You can put this solution on YOUR website! If the winning candidate secured 57% of the votes, and won by a majority of 42000, then the opponent received 43% of the votes cast. Let n represent the total amount of votes cast. Then:
(57-43)% of n=42000
.14n=42000
n=300000
300000 total votes were cast. ☺☺☺☺
